Showroom B2B Launches Noida Unit to Strengthen Apparel Supply Chain

Jungle Ventures backed Showroom B2B opens new Noida manufacturing unit to strengthen domestic & global apparel supply chain

New Delhi, 1st August 2025: Showroom B2B, India’s fastest-growing B2B platform for value fashion retailers, has launched a new manufacturing hub in Noida to expand its in-house production of denim, kurtis, and core fashion lines. Designed to serve both domestic and international markets, the facility marks a major milestone in the company’s journey to streamline sourcing, control quality, and support retail growth through vertically integrated operations.

Commercial operations at the unit began on June 2, 2025, with a phased ramp-up planned through the month. The facility has a monthly production capacity of 150,000 garments, contributing to Showroom B2B’s total manufacturing capacity of 400,000 pieces per month.

“We’re building for scale, precision, and predictability,” said Abhishek Dua, co-founder and CEO at Showroom B2B. “This facility isn’t just about increasing output, it’s about creating a responsive, digitally connected supply chain that reflects where value fashion is headed, both in India and globally.”

Looking ahead, Showroom B2B has outlined an ambitious five-year plan aimed at scaling responsibly while keeping a close pulse on market needs. “We will be doubling our topline revenue every single year of operation for the next five years with a revenue goal of ₹2,500 crores,” said Dua. “The industry is becoming more fast fashion-oriented, and we’re aligning our sourcing strategy by making it more agile and responsive”

The new manufacturing unit is expected to generate an additional $8 million in annual revenue, reflecting rising demand from both Indian retail partners and international clients. While the initial export focus will be on core styles, the facility is built with the flexibility to scale exports in line with global partnerships. Currently, Showroom B2B serves large value chains such as Vishal Mega Mart, and Reliance Retail, and has initiated pilot exports to USA, Middle East and Europe with plans to expand further in the next 12 months.

The Noida unit will generate employment for over 300 people directly and indirectly, with a targeted effort to ensure that 50% of production roles are filled by women, reinforcing Showroom B2B’s commitment to inclusive growth.

“This facility is a tech-forward response to what fashion retailers increasingly expect i.e. speed, transparency, and supply chain reliability,” added Abhishek. “We expect to achieve ROI on this facility within 12 months, driven by faster order turnaround, improved margins, and rising export demand.”

Rather than expanding volume for its growth, the company is focused on scaling in step with market signals, adjusting capacity and style offerings based on real-time feedback from its vast retail network.

While the unit will serve Showroom B2B’s expanding domestic retailer base, it is also future-ready for international markets, particularly clients in the U.S., Middle East and Europe. Built to global standards, the facility will play a pivotal role in broadening the company’s presence in fashion-forward export destinations.
